  1. As a quick diagnosis, instrument cluster will perform a function check immediately after ignition is switched to RUN/START position. Electronic display, odometer/transmission range indicator and all warning lights EXCEPT low fuel, cruise, high beam, fog lamps and turn signal will light for a brief period.
  2. If cluster is not receiving CCD bus messages, cluster will appear non-functional except for the continuously illuminated air bag indicator. If instrument cluster in not receiving CCD bus messages, see VEHICLE COMMUNICATIONS in BODY CONTROL COMPUTER article in the ACCESSORIES/SAFETY EQUIPMENT section.
CAUTION: When battery is disconnected, vehicle computer and memory systems may lose memory data. Driveability problems may exist until computer systems have completed a relearn cycle. See COMPUTER RELEARN PROCEDURES article in the GENERAL INFORMATION section before disconnecting battery.
WARNING: Disconnect negative battery cable BEFORE servicing instrument panel. When power is required for test purposes, reconnect battery for specific test purpose ONLY. After specific test is completed, disconnect negative battery cable before continuing servicing procedures.
